What is RTP and Why Does it Matter?

RTP is the theoretical percentage of all wagered money that a pokie will pay back to players over a long period. For example, if a pokie has a 98% RTP, the “house edge” is only 2%.

While RTP doesn’t guarantee a win in a single session (due to short-term variance), playing games with higher percentages significantly improves your odds of sustaining your balance over time. In 2026, any pokie with an RTP below 96% is considered “below average” in the Australian market.

Understanding the Relationship Between RTP and Volatility

A common mistake is assuming a High RTP means “easy wins.” You must also consider Volatility:

  • High RTP + Low Volatility: (e.g., 1429 Uncharted Seas) These games provide frequent, smaller wins. They are perfect for meeting wagering requirements on bonuses because your balance stays relatively stable.
  • High RTP + High Volatility: (e.g., Book of 99) These games pay back a lot over time, but the wins are “clumpy.” You might go many spins without a win, followed by a massive payout. You need a larger bankroll to weather the dry spells in these games.

Tips for Playing High RTP Games

  1. Avoid “RTP Ranges”: Some providers allow casinos to choose from a range of RTPs (e.g., 91%, 94%, or 96%). Always verify the specific RTP in the game’s settings to ensure you aren’t playing a lower-paying version.
  2. Focus on “Buy Feature” Stats: In some modern pokies, the RTP actually increases if you use the “Buy Bonus” or “Feature Buy” option. For instance, a game might have a base RTP of 96.2% that jumps to 97% during a purchased bonus round.
  3. Use High RTP for Bonuses: If you have a casino bonus with a 35x wagering requirement, playing a 98% RTP game like Blood Suckers gives you the highest statistical chance of having money left over once the wagering is complete.
